Magda Duprey

During a battle with a monster, Chet Fields’ Venusian assistant Ronjli informs him of a business call. Chet kills the beast quickly and answers the call from Wagner Duprey. Duprey wishes to hire Fields to lead a hunting expedition to Venus. When Fields meets Duprey, he discovers Duprey’s niece Magda Duprey must go on the expedition, too. A bit of a chauvinist, Fields initially balks at a woman on the trip, but Duprey doubles his pay and Fields agrees. At the start of the expedition, Fields insists Magda be carried in a chair by Venusian natives. After three days, they resort to using Mud Walkers to manage the terrain. Magda says the chair fell in the swamp. Fields replies they will simply build another. Magda begs Fields to not do so, saying she will be more agreeable. Duprey enjoys seeing his niece be more subdued. The party encounters a variety of Venusian creatures, including Venusian sabertooth tigers. Magda sees a butterfly, but Duprey pushes her out of the way as the butterfly is actually a Darterfly that spits poison. The poison hits and kills one of the natives. Later, they run across a Venusian Wolf, which Duprey dispatches with his rifle. Ronjli warns them of the dangerous Winged People. Fields refuses to continue on with such a threat looming, but Magda convinces Fields to stick to the plan. His hesitancy is proven out, however, as the winged soldiers scoop them up and take them to their city, and the court of the Winged King. The King tells them that the “Sacred Jewel Eye of Amacinth” was stolen by an Earthling three decades earlier. The group is to be imprisoned for the crime. Magda despairs of ever escaping the prison, but Wagner Duprey reveals he has escaped before and would do so again, as he was the one who stole the “Jewel Eye” in the first place. Duprey sold the eye to build his empire, but has lost the money. He came to steal the other “Eye of Amacinth”. Magda and Fields are angry at Wagner, but when a winged guard overhears and attacks Wagner, Mr. Duprey manages to defeat him. The three work together to escape with the guard’s lasso. Wagner ducks out to attempt to steal the other eye from the massive statue of Amacinth. While he’s digging out the jewel, a “death ray” from a giant gem on the opposite wall is triggered, killing him. Finding some wings on nearby statues, Magda and Fields slip out of the city. Some days later, they find Ronjli, who is excited at their survival. Magda thanks Fields, saying she loves him. Fields says now that she’s broke, he guesses he loves her too.
Alias Magda Duprey
Real Names/Alt Names Magda Duprey
Characteristics Ziff-Davis Universe, The Future
Creators/Key Contributors Wally Wood
First Appearance Amazing Adventures #1 (1950)
First Publisher Ziff-Davis [CB+] [GCD] [DCM]
Appearance List Amazing Adventures #1
